Abstract
A novel optical control system using nematic liquid crystals and acoustooptic devices is introduced that can provide compact, lightweight, low cost, transmit/receive mode, high performance (greater than 8 bits), truly analog, amplitude and phase control for large phased array antennas. The system provides independent amplitude and phase calibration and control capabilities across the array.
